Kung Pao Chicken (Spicy Stir-fry Chicken)


...known as Kungpo Chicken in restaurants, is a spicy stir-fry chicken...
The cooking style - Kung Pao is originated from the Sichuan province of China. The authentic Kung Pao Chicken calls for Sichuan peppercorns but here in Malaysia Kung Pao Chicken or more known as Kungpo Chicken (宫保鸡丁), is a spicy stir-fry chicken with dried chillies, onions, ginger, spring onions and top with roasted cashew nuts.

KUNG PAO CHICKEN (SPICY STIR-FRY CHICKEN)
Prep Time  : 20 mins
Cook Time : 10 mins
Total Time : 30 mins
Serves       : 2 pax

Ingredients:
1 whole leg chicken (400g), deboned and cubed
5 slices ginger
1 stalk spring onion, cut into 3-4cm length
1 red onion, wedges
5 pcs dried chillies
1/4 cup roasted unsalted peanuts/ cashew nuts

Marinade
1 Tbsp oyster sauce
1 Tbsp vegetable oil

Seasoning (Combined in a small bowl)
2 Tbsp light soy sauce
1 Tbsp oyster sauce
1 Tbsp chilli sauce
1 tsp rice vinegar
2 tsp sugar or to taste

Thickening (Combined)
1 tsp tapioca starch
1 Tbsp water

Directions:
1. Marinade chicken with oyster sauce and vegetable oil for 15 minutes.

2. Heat approx. 2 tablespoons of oil in a wok, stir-fry dried red chillies, ginger and spring onions until aromatic.

3. Add in onion wedges and chicken cubes and stir-fry until the chicken is cooked. Pour the seasoning in and stir-fry till fragrant. Thicken with starch mixture. Dish up and sprinkle with roasted peanuts and some chopped spring onions.

Notes:
● I am using extra hot dried chillies. If you are using the normal type, you may use upto 10-15pcs.
